Maximizing Your Physical Therapist Earnings in Woodstock

While senior physical therapist pay in GA is commendable, geographic and sectoral differences still play a critical role in compensation dynamics. Specializations such as orthopedic (OCS) and sports physical therapy (SCS) command higher salaries in Woodstock, as do advanced credentials like board certifications. Furthermore, pay can vary significantly based on the type of employer; for instance, outpatient orthopedic clinics might offer less base salary than hospital systems but could supplement this with productivity bonuses and incentives related to patient volume. Senior roles such as clinic director or faculty in DPT programs not only elevate earning potential but also enhance professional stature within the field. The evolving landscape of healthcare—characterized by fluctuating reimbursement models and increasing emphasis on cash-pay services—adds further layers of complexity for experienced physical therapists contemplating their next career steps.
